Is there a way to include others in my Bitcoin wallet for joint ownership?
I would like to know if there is a method to add other individuals to my Bitcoin wallet so that we can have joint ownership. Is it possible to share the ownership of a Bitcoin wallet with others? How can I include others in my Bitcoin wallet for joint ownership?
3 answers
- playergamesproNov 16, 2020 · 6 years agoYes, it is possible to include others in your Bitcoin wallet for joint ownership. One way to achieve this is by using a multi-signature wallet. A multi-signature wallet requires multiple signatures to authorize transactions, ensuring that no single individual has complete control over the funds. Each participant in the joint ownership would have their own private key, and a transaction would require a certain number of signatures to be valid. This method provides an added layer of security and allows for shared control of the Bitcoin wallet.
